Postby The Dark Knight » Thu Dec 13, 2018 8:21 pm

Dutchy wrote:Ashwin out for Perth, they dont lose much with his replacement though in Jadeja. I rate him highly, will strengthen their lower order also.
I do not rate Jadeja, still think Kuldeep Yadav was worth a go ahead of him.
144 wickets @19.70 at home in 28 matches
41 wickets @36.82 away in 11 matches
Averages 23.55 with the bat against Aus
Never played against Aus in Aus

No Rohit Sharma hinders Australia I reckon, he is the biggest flat track bully in world cricket (Dave Warner is one yes but at least has had sustained success in test cricket)
